The Meath Epilepsy Charity is seeking a Quality & Compliance Officer (Medication Governance) to lead medication safety across residential services.

You will conduct monthly digital audits, review e MAR records, and produce governance reports to support high‑quality, person‑centred care.

Reporting to the Quality & Compliance Manager, you will collaborate with pharmacy and GP colleagues, drive improvement, and train staff to uphold standards and best practice across all services.
